By now, regular readers of this site will be familiar with the rationale behind having a disaster recovery plan. IT Pro offers a series of tips to take a company’s disaster planning to the next level.
Tips include:
- Having robust documentation, which is especially useful to get management buy-in.
- Consider all areas of business in terms of risk and have a full IT inventory and data audit.
- Have regular fire drills and tests of your plan.
- Prepare for different levels of disaster, not just one type of occurrence.
- Consider the pros and cons of cloud DR: how they integrate with your business and the upfront costs.
- Avoid single points of failure and consider resilience first.
- Be ready to update and revise your plan as needed with new additions to your inventory and networks.
